Output 62b4b21a583883591e99ae243ae21a7a518da303a3b1b9b3a8757636000f1195:0

value
26142
script pubkey
OP_0 OP_PUSHBYTES_20 29d84703a244698ce7702331a46fec072e70e02d
address
bc1q98vywqazg35ceemsyvc6gmlvquh8pcpdvzds29
transaction
62b4b21a583883591e99ae243ae21a7a518da303a3b1b9b3a8757636000f1195